Another 1-2-3- santander question

I have just successfully applied for a Santander 1-2-3 account and have received my welcome documents. I believe you have the option of setting up direct debit/standing orders which will earn you cashback. Now I have a couple of regular saving accounts at other building societies which I want to fund from my new santander account so could I set up standing orders to do this and also qualify for a cashback? or is this for bill direct debits/standing orders only?

    thor wrote: »
    ...Now I have a couple of regular saving accounts at other building societies which I want to fund from my new santander account so could I set up standing orders to do this and also qualify for a cashback? or is this for bill direct debits/standing orders only?

    You'll only receive cashback on Direct Debits (not Standing Orders) for household bills. HERE's a link for those bills that are eligible.

    Had you read the T&C's of the account when you applied you would have seen that its for Direct debits to certain organisations that get you the cash back.

    Are you also aware that there is minnimum £500 a month funding required and a £2 a month fee for this account? Your standing orders to other account will get you nothing.

    I must admit that I only gave the T&Cs a cursory glance. I knew about the monthly funding of £500 but I do not have any direct debits going out anywhere so was only speculating if I could use standing Orders to generate cashbacks.
    The £2 monthly fee does not bother me one bit as the main reason I applied for this account was that Santander had reduced their 2.8% Cash ISA to 2.0% and I had to get the 1-2-3 account to qualify for the 3.0% cash ISA which is still around(so far).
